Detailed Description
In order to make the technical means, creation features, achievement purposes and functions of the present invention easy to understand, the present invention is further described below with reference to the following embodiments.
As shown in fig. 1-3, a polishing device for casting a transmission comprises a base 18, an upright rod 9 and a reinforcing rib 16, wherein the upright rod 9 is installed at the top of the base 18 through a bolt, one side of the top end of the upright rod 9 is connected with a spring part 11 through a butt joint piece 10, the other end part of the spring part 11 is provided with a rotating plate 12 through a bolt, one end part of the rotating plate 12 is provided with a motor base through a butt joint plate 15, the top part of the motor base is provided with a servo motor 14 through a bolt, the top part of the rotating plate 12 is provided with a fixed table 7, one end of the fixed table 7 is provided with a grinding motor 6 through a bolt, an output shaft of the grinding motor 6 is provided with a linkage rod 2 through a bolt, the bottom part of the linkage rod 2 is provided with a grinding wheel 4 through a bolt, one end of the rotating plate 12 is, an output shaft of the servo motor 14 is connected with a screw rod 5, and the screw rod 5 penetrates through a screw block 8.
The top of the servo motor 14 is provided with a servo motor controller 13 through a screw, and the output end of the servo motor controller 13 is electrically connected with the input end of the servo motor 14 through a wire.
In this embodiment, as shown in fig. 1, the servo motor 14 is automatically controlled by the servo motor controller 13 to operate, so as to control the rotation speed, meet different polishing strengths, and effectively prolong the service life.
The linkage rod 2 is sleeved with a shaft sleeve 3, one side of the shaft sleeve 3 is provided with a sliding block, and the sliding block is located in the sliding rail 1.
Wherein, a reinforcing rib 16 is installed on one side of the vertical rod 9 through a bolt, and a balancing weight 17 is arranged at one end of the top of the base 18.
In this embodiment, as shown in fig. 1, the reinforcing ribs 16 make the vertical rod have high stability, difficult deformation and durability.
The bottom of the fixed table 7 is provided with a sliding block, the top of the rotating plate 12 is embedded with a sliding groove 19, and the sliding block is located in the sliding groove 19.
In this embodiment, as shown in fig. 1, the sliding block is located in the sliding groove 19 to enable the grinding motor 6 to slide back and forth, and the stability is high.
It should be noted that, the utility model relates to a transmission casting polishing device, during operation, the transmission is placed at one end of the top of the base 18, the region of one side of the transmission needing to be polished extrudes the polishing wheel 4, the polishing wheel 4 plays a role in buffering and energy dissipation in the polishing process under the tension of the spring part 11, and the polishing device avoids excessive polishing and influences polishing attractiveness; the screw rod 5 is driven to rotate through the servo motor 14, the shaft sleeve 3 is limited by the slide block and the slide rail 1, the screw block 8 slides on the screw rod 5, and therefore the polishing wheel 4 polishes back and forth in a region to be polished, and the buffering performance is remarkable; the servo motor 14 is automatically controlled to work through a servo motor controller 13 (Jinan electronics technology limited company), the rotation speed is controlled, different polishing strengths are met, and the service life is effectively prolonged; balancing weight 17 makes the in-process that the integrated device polished more stable, and this novel burnishing device is used in derailleur casting function is various, easy operation, and the production of being convenient for has satisfied the multiple demand in the use, is fit for extensively using widely.
